West Indies captain Matthews backs underdog side ahead of Australia semi-final

West Indies will face Australia in a ICC tournament semi-final at The Oval on Tuesday. Captain Hayley Matthews acknowledged her side enters the match as underdogs but expressed confidence in the team's ability to defy expectations. Matthews described the pressure-free position as an advantage, suggesting the team has nothing to lose against the high-flying Australians. She rallied her squad with a message of proving their critics wrong on the big stage.
